Bug 24865

Summary: Не хватает зависимости
Product: Sisyphus Reporter: Pavel Vainerman <pv>
Component: tuxguitarAssignee: Vitaly Lipatov <lav>
Status: CLOSED FIXED QA Contact: qa-sisyphus
Severity: normal    
Priority: P3    
Version: unstable   
Hardware: all   
OS: Linux   

Description Pavel Vainerman 2011-01-06 15:42:06 MSK
Попытался запустить tuxguitar. Получил

[pv@pvbook Torrent]$ tuxguitar 
Exception in thread "main" java.lang.NoClassDefFoundError: org/eclipse/swt/widgets/Control
        at org.herac.tuxguitar.gui.TGMain.main(Unknown Source)
Caused by: java.lang.ClassNotFoundException: org.eclipse.swt.widgets.Control
        at java.net.URLClassLoader$1.run(URLClassLoader.java:217)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.net.URLClassLoader.findClass(URLClassLoader.java:205)
        at java.lang.ClassLoader.loadClass(ClassLoader.java:321)
        at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:294)
        at java.lang.ClassLoader.loadClass(ClassLoader.java:266)
        ... 1 more


Помогла установка пакета eclipse-swt
Comment 1 Vitaly Lipatov 2011-01-06 18:35:26 MSK
Да, не вписал...
Comment 2 Repository Robot 2011-01-06 20:48:31 MSK
tuxguitar-1.2-alt1 -> sisyphus:

* Thu Jan 06 2011 Vitaly Lipatov <lav@altlinux> 1.2-alt1
- new version 1.2 (with rpmrb script)
- add requires to eclipse-swt (ALT #24865)
- use Fedora's spec
Comment 3 Vitaly Lipatov 2011-01-06 21:26:41 MSK
У меня стал возникать SEGSEGV с ошибкой:
C  [libtuxguitar-alsa-jni.so+0x11d1]  Java_org_herac_tuxguitar_player_impl_midiport_alsa_MidiSystem_findPorts+0xe1 
Это https://bugzilla.redhat.com/show_bug.cgi?id=661562
Отладить пока не смог, потому что при компиляции этого плагина (
tuxguitar-src/TuxGuitar-alsa/jni ) с -g всё начинает работать :)